Parks And Rec Reunion: Series Creator Says You Shouldn't Look For Easter Eggs

The cast of NBC’s beloved workplace comedy Parks and Recreation are reuniting for a special one-off episode that will help raise money for COVID-19 relief. Series co-creator Mike Schur has now shared some more details about the show, including information about the plot and how it was filmed.

During a conference call attended by The Hollywood Reporter, Schur said the story will involve Amy Poehler’s Leslie Knope trying to maintain a sense of normalcy and connectedness during the COVID-19 crisis where people are physically separated.

“The whole special is not about the disease,” Schur said. “It’s about people coping with it and navigating their daily lives. The most important theme of the show is: Leslie Knope believes in friendship. She was loyal and friendly and put all her eggs in the power of friendship. It’s about her connecting with people and holding that group of characters together at a time when they’re unable to leave their homes. That’s the running theme.”

The episode is canon, but fans hoping for it to reveal details about what happens next to Leslie Knope in her political career won’t get any answers. “We made a bunch of references in the finale to potential things that might happen to various people and we left all that out,” Schur said. “We wanted this to be about what was happening in their life at this moment. There are no future Easter eggs–at least none that are intentional, anyway.”

Schur also confirmed that the special will give a story explanation for why the Parks and Rec couples, including Leslie and Ben, Ann and Chris, and April and Andy, are separated during the lockdowns.

The cast filmed themselves using iPhones, while Scur and other producers watched the shoots on Zoom to provide direction. It was a “slow and laborious” production, Schur noted, adding that this is not a sustainable way for making episodes of television.

The Parks and Rec special airs this Thursday, April 30, on NBC. All 10 members of the main cast are set to appear, including Poehler, Rashida Jones, Aziz Ansari, Aubrey Plaza, Nick Offerman, Chris Pratt, Rob Lowe, Adam Scott, Jim O’Heir, and Retta
